为什么gcc输出机器代码有nop指令
Everytime I do an objdump -d I always see the asm code with batches of nop instructions (instructions that do nothing) 每次我做一个objdump -d我总是看到asm代码与批量的n...
连载:面向对象葵花宝典:思想、技巧与实践(35) - NOP原则
NOP,No Overdesign Priciple,不要过度设计原则。 这应该是你第一次看到这个原则,而且你也不用上网查了,因为这个不是大师们创造的,而是我创造的:) 之所以提出这个原则,是我自己吃过苦头,也在工作中见很多人吃过类似的苦头。 你可能也见过这样的场景: 产品提出了一个需求...
[转]学习Nop中Routes的使用
本文转自:http://www.cnblogs.com/miku/archive/2012/09/27/2706276.html1. 映射路由大型MVC项目为了扩展性,可维护性不能像一般项目在Global中RegisterRoutes的方法里面映射路由。这里学习一下Nop是如何做的。Global.c...
嵌入式开发之精确延时---多线程延时阻塞精度asm("nop") nanosleep usleep sleep select
http://blog.csdn.net/lile777/article/details/45503087
c# (nop中)下拉列表(有外键)
第一种情况。view视图加载出来时就有值,,实现步骤如下1.在操作的界面Model中建立public List<SelectListItem> xxx(取名){ get; set; }2.在Model中的构造函数中实例化this.Courses = new List<SelectL...
nopCommerce 学习之路(一)Nop之强制拆迁
一、nop简介 按照国际惯例,先介绍一下文章的主角——nopCommerce,于是,以下内容来自百度百科: nopcommerce是国外的一个高质量的开源b2c网站系统,基于EntityFramework4.0和 MVC3.0,使用Razor模板引擎,有很强的插件机制,包括支付配送功...
nop4.1学习ServiceCollectionExtensions(二)
这个是获取程序路径,并初始化文件管理类 初始化插件管理 接下来就是注册服务和autoafc ...
框架的 总结(nop)------添加功能
一。添加功能 1.首先需要在前端显示界面View视图中添加 <div class="pull-right"> <a href="@Url.Action("Create")" class="btn btn-default">@T("添加")</a><...
破解第一课:NOP绕过登录界面
第一步 打开软件,任意输入密码,提示“用户密码错误还有2次机会” 第二步 OD载入软件,右键-----中文搜索引擎---智能搜索 按下CTRL+F,打开查找,输入“密码错误”,在结果中双击找到的结果 回到主界面,发现验证过程是有一个跳转来实现的 注意: 1 最左边的红色圈标记的右箭头图标。...
Nop源码分析一
从Global.asax文件开始逐层分析Nop的架构。Application_Start()方法作为mvc启动的第一个方法。1,首先初始化一个引擎上下文,如下面的代码: EngineContext.Initialize(false);引擎实现了IEngine接口,该接口定义如下:public int...
连载:面向对象葵花宝典:思想、技巧与实践(35) - NOP原则
NOP,No Overdesign Priciple,不要过度设计原则。 这应该是你第一次看到这个原则,而且你也不用上网查了,因为这个不是大师们创造的,而是我创造的:) 之所以提出这个原则,是我自己吃过苦头,也在工作中见很多人吃过类似的苦头。 你可能也见过这样的场景: 产品提出了一个需求...
基于nopcommerce b2c开源项目的精简版开发框架Nop.Framework
http://www.17ky.net/soft/70612.html?v=1#0-sqq-1-39009-9737f6f9e09dfaf5d3fd14d775bfee85项目详细介绍该开源项目是博客园的网友 徐领 发布的的一款基于b2c开源项目nopCommerce的开发框架,名叫Nop.Fram...
arm nop延时方法
条件,FCLK=200M PCLK=100M,HCLK 100M 并且开启MMU,内存进行映射的情况下 延时函数如下 void delay_pw(void) 3.25us{int i,j; for(j=2;j>0;j--) {for(i=0;i<50;i++) { ...